Capricornia Coastal Waters
St Lawrence to Burnett Heads- Wind
- Southeasterly 15 to 20 knots.
- Seas
- Around 1 metre, increasing to 1 to 1.5 metres offshore south of Cape Capricorn.
- 1st Swell
- Easterly below 1 metre inshore, increasing to 1 to 1.5 metres offshore.
- Weather
- Partly cloudy. 50% chance of showers.
- Weather Situation
- A high [1029 hPa] moving into the Tasman Sea extends a ridge over the southern waters. The ridge will persist for several days, weakening slightly today before strengthening again over the weekend a new high moves slowly across the Bight. A fresh to strong southerly winds will extend over much of the southern waters this weekend and persist into early next week.
